Pallavi and Bindhumalini explore the theme of gender as they journey from birth to liberation, from form to the formless, through the words and eyes of women across the world.

The Threshold is a musical conversation between Pallavi and Bindhumalini that celebrates the stories of women across continents and generations. Through the stories of Hypatia, Agnodice, Kharbaoucha, and Fanny Mendelssohn, and the songs of Lalla, Lingamma, Neelamma, Goggavva, Sule Sunkkavva, Nina Simone, and Meera, Pallavi and Bindhu weave a journey of womanhood, accentuating their voices with the sounds of the harmonium, flute, kazoo, swarmandal, udukkai, bells, ghungroo, shakers, kartal, melodica, rainmaker, and banjo.

This event is part of the programming to celebrate the last month of our first permanent exhibition, VISIBLE/INVISIBLE.

Bindhumalini Narayanaswamy

Bindhumalini Narayanaswamy is a singer, composer. Bindhu constantly strives to explore avenues outside of her classical roots to play with the soul stirring power that music has. She has journeyed to various hamlets, villages, cities and countries sharing the songs and poems of various mystic saints of India. She directed music for feature and documentary films in Tamil, Kannada and other languages.

She won the National Award and Filmfare Award as Best Singer for the songs she created and sang in the film Nathicharami

Bindhumalini has been expanding her craft, community and repertoire through multidisciplinary collaborations

Pallavi MD

Pallavi MD is a singer, composer, actor, editor, sound designer and filmmaker. She has a degree in Hindustani classical music from Benares University. She has been performing Kannada poetry (bhavageethe) across Karnataka and abroad for the last twenty five years. She has won the META Best Actress award for her solo theatrical piece C Sharp C Blunt. She has won the State award for her song in the film Duniya, and the State Kempegowda award for her contribution in the field of music. She has acted in Girish Kasaravalli’s Gulabi Talkies and Prakash Belawadi’s Stumble- both National award winning films. ‘Playgrounds’ a short film she co-wrote and directed, won the best film award in the Hong Kong Film Festival and at IFFLA, Los Angeles.

She has been awarded the prestigious Ustad Bismillah Khan Yuva Puraskar (National Award) for her contribution to the field of Bhav Sangeet (singing poetry). In 2024, she has composed music for the Broadway play ‘The Vanishing Elephant’. In 2024, she designed the music for ‘Banjara Virasat’, an experiential museum that documents the life and culture of the Banjara community. Her collaborative LP with German musician Andi Otto, ‘Song For Broken Ships’ was nominated for the prestigious German Record Critics’ Award in 2024. Her collaborative Single ‘Simchezo’ won the Best Composition Award from international collaborative platform- Beyond Music in 2024.

She has just finished co-composing music for Kavan- an Ambedkarite opera that premiered in Mumbai.
